Features and description

This smart one-bedroom apartment is on the first floor of a handsome Victorian townhouse on Powis Square, near Westbourne Grove, Portobello Road and Notting Hill. A double-height living space forms the crux of the plan, with a towering trio of sash windows set in a wide bay. Its spaces have been cleverly configured to sit separate from one another while forming part of a subtly interconnected whole.



The Tour



Powis Square is a peaceful residential road set back from, but within easy reach of, the buzz of the surrounding area. Entry is via a set of steps that lead to a smart black front door; beyond is a communal hallway and staircase that leads to the apartment’s private first-floor entrance.



From here is a hallway that reaches to the light-filled living space at the fore. Solid oak floorboards ground much of the plan and charcoal-grey cast-iron radiators warm throughout.



A tripartite bay floods the room with light, enhancing the warm tones of the surrounding exposed brick walls. The room lends itself well to flexible arrangements; the current owners have placed a large dining table in the space in front of the window, and a relaxed seating area behind.



The kitchen extends from the entrance hallway and has attractive bespoke cabinets above and below a natural stone countertop. A four-ring hob is set beneath a cut-out section of wall, a clever detail that allows for simultaneous cooking and hosting.



Tall doors concertina to reveal the bedroom, also at the rear of the apartment. When left open, the light from a sash window amplifies that from the living room sash windows. A bank of cupboards on one side provides plenty of storage space, while built-in shelves opposite provide a space for books and a reading light.



A dark counterpoint to the otherwise bright plan, the bathroom lies off the entrance hallway. Slate grey tiles wrap part of its walls and ground a walk-in shower with a large rainfall-style shower head above. A copper sink reflects light and sits above an antique wooden Unit.



The Area



One of west London’s most desirable areas, Powis Square is situated opposite the Tabernacle theatre and is five minutes’ walk from the boutiques of Westbourne Grove and Portobello Road, including its world-famous market.



The immediate area is replete with popular places to eat, including the two Michelin-starred Ledbury, Granger & Co and Ottolenghi. Further bars, restaurants and pubs can be found in nearby Notting Hill, as can The Electric Cinema and popular Notting Hill Arts Club. We’ve written more about the area in our Journal.

Transport connections in the area are excellent, with Westbourne Park and Ladbroke Grove (Hammersmith & City and Circle line), and Notting Hill Gate (Central line) all within approximately 10 minutes' walk away.

Tenure: Share of Freehold | Length of Lease: Approx. 84 years remaining | Service Charge: Approx. £1,800 per annum | Ground Rent: None | Council Tax Band: E
